I ordered some slotted brembo rotors from gotham racing, for both front and rear and I do understand that all they are are brembo rotors that have been machined. As for my pads I got EBC Reds for the front, and EBC Greens for the rear. IMOP I was pissed at first I never relised how much those basterds were going to sqeal only as I came to a stop like last 7-5mph to 0mph) but other than that they were great. Now that the "break in" coating has wore off they no longer sqeal, I must say when I first start braking they dont feel right but give that fricion a fraction of a sec to build and wow thats some stopping power, now that they have gotten settled I put them to the test, 130mph and didnt stuff the brakes but I did put some pressure on them and damn down to 60mph faster than I thought. the SRT-4 that was attemping to keep up and follow me had to keep going to the next exit, poor bastred hehe, THE WIFE WANTED A NEON, HE WANTED A FAST CAR, so they got a SRT-4 when it boils down to it, its still a neon... anywho overall on the brakes I would recommend them in a heart beat, and put money on it you would love them, that is if you like to stop on a dime.

Now for the Koni's and H&R's, It took me a while to decide on what I wanted to get I was at fist going to price, but I always will choose quality over anything. The set-up I got just so happend to be used and off this fourm, great price, and a great produts. As for chooseing the spings I really wanted a stiff spring where I would feel the road and imporve the handling, and lower it a hair. Well I must say when I got the parts they were in very good condtion and clean, the install when as smooth as I thought untill I smashed my fingers but lets skip that as it only brings me anger... After I got them in and drove it around for a few to "settle" them in I got out and looked at the stace HOLY ****!!!! IT GOT LOW!!!! lower that I expected but DAMN it looks good drool...and the hadleing has improved greatly and the launch "throw back" is next to none, and the brake nose dip is nearly eliminated, the ride is to my suprise smooth, stiff but really smooth, and the corering is beyond what I expected, if it werent for me rubbing my fenders it would be what I would call perfect, with the execption to a squeak got on the rear passander side, still have no idea what the hell is it all I know it must die. I highly reccomend both the springs and struts if you want a smooth stiff and aggressive stance, the one thing I do reccomecd doing is and aliment, as you should with anywork to this nature.
